Your Skin’s Protective Barrier: How It Works (And How Chlorine Disrupts It)

Your skin is coated with a microbiome, a delicate layer of beneficial bacteria that helps:
Regulate hydration by maintaining the skin’s natural oils
Protect against irritants by forming a defensive shield
Balance pH levels to keep the skin smooth and clear

But here’s where chlorine becomes a problem. Chlorine is added to tap water as a disinfectant to kill bacteria and pathogens. While they add it for drinking water safety, your skin microbiome isn’t a pathogen, it’s a vital part of your body’s defense system.

🔬 Scientific findings confirm that chlorine exposure:

  • Strips away the skin’s natural lipid barrier, leading to increased water loss and dehydration.
  • Alters the skin’s microbiome, disrupting the balance of beneficial bacteria that protect against irritation.
  • Contributes to oxidative stress, which accelerates skin aging and weakens the epidermis.

Over time, repeated exposure to chlorinated water can leave skin feeling tight, dry, irritated, and more prone to sensitivity.
